Ownership group

Per CMS filings, this facility is affiliated with Pivotal Health Care, a group operating 9 facilities in 3 states. Group record: average rating 4.0/5, 0 abuse citation icons, 0 facilities on the Special Focus list, $0 in federal fines. This facility rates the same as its group average (4.0/5).

Staffing (hours per resident per day)

Total nurse staffing: 5.11 (Kansas median: 3.94). RN hours: 1.22. Weekend total: 4.80. Nursing staff turnover: 58%.
